Subject: LockerFlow on-call notes

Hi Dariel,

Welcome to the rotation. You'll mostly see review requests touching the locker access flow in SpinCycle — the service that issues door codes for the Hullbrook laundry lockers. Key things to check: code expiry is enforced server-side, retries are idempotent, and nothing logs the raw door code. Reject any change that bypasses the access audit middleware. The review checklist and flow diagrams live on the internal page below.

Thanks,
Noor

dashboard of kajep-tajog = https://harbor.tolvaqworks.example/pipeline/run/dash/pipeline/228e278bbf9b3bc2

Hey — handing off Tollgate Pay before I'm out. Quick context: we switched retry logic so the idempotency key is derived from the order hash, not a random UUID, which stopped the double-refund mess from the Brennick batch job. If retries start failing with key-conflict errors tonight, it's almost certainly a clock-skew thing on worker three. For reference, the service currently runs with these values.

deployment values, yafof-tawig:
quenath:
  log_level: info
  metrics_host: metrics.quenath.zemvarsys.internal
  pin: 5568
  pool_size: 8

**Ticket #4471 — Monthly partitions not visible to plugins**

Hey plugin folks — if you're building against the Quartzbin storage API, heads up: tables partitioned by month aren't showing child partitions through `listTables()` right now. Only the parent shows up, so month-scoped queries from plugins silently return empty sets. Fix lands in the next Quartzbin point release. To confirm you're on the patched build, check that your runtime reports the token below.

pipeline stamp: htk31_f769b577b3028a4e9958e5bb8d1259a

Action item from the Brindlewick kiosk outage: the watchdog on the Ordertide app was way too trigger-happy, restarting the UI mid-transaction whenever the scanner lagged. Marisol's fix loosens the restart thresholds and adds a grace window after boot. Please verify the new constants land in the 4.2 release build. The tuned values are as follows.

limits module of yadug-yagap:
RATE_LIMITS = {
    "quenix": 5,
    "druwyn": 2,
}